About Probate Law in Alexandria, Egypt:

Probate is the legal process of validating a will and distributing the assets of a deceased person in Alexandria, Egypt. This process ensures that the deceased person's wishes are followed and their assets are distributed according to the law.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

You may need a lawyer in Probate cases if you are facing disputes over the validity of a will, if you are an executor of a will and need assistance with the probate process, or if you need help with estate planning to ensure your assets are distributed according to your wishes.

Local Laws Overview:

In Alexandria, Egypt, Probate laws are governed by the Civil Code. These laws outline the procedures for validating a will, appointing an executor, and distributing assets. It is important to seek legal advice to ensure that you are following the correct procedures and laws.

Frequently Asked Questions:

1. What is the probate process in Alexandria, Egypt?

The probate process involves validating the will, appointing an executor, and distributing the assets according to the law.

2. How long does the probate process take in Alexandria, Egypt?

The probate process can vary depending on the complexity of the case and any disputes that may arise. It can take several months to a year to complete.

3. Do I need a lawyer for probate in Alexandria, Egypt?

While it is not required to have a lawyer for probate, it is highly recommended to seek legal advice to ensure that the process is completed correctly.

4. What happens if there is no will in Alexandria, Egypt?

If there is no will, the assets of the deceased person will be distributed according to the laws of intestacy in Alexandria, Egypt.

5. Can a will be contested in Alexandria, Egypt?

Yes, a will can be contested in Alexandria, Egypt if there are concerns about its validity or if there are disputes among beneficiaries.

6. How are taxes handled in probate cases in Alexandria, Egypt?

Taxes on the estate and assets are typically handled during the probate process in Alexandria, Egypt. It is important to seek legal advice to ensure that taxes are paid correctly.

7. Can an executor be removed in Alexandria, Egypt?

Yes, an executor can be removed in Alexandria, Egypt if they are not fulfilling their duties or if there are conflicts of interest.

8. What are the responsibilities of an executor in Alexandria, Egypt?

The responsibilities of an executor include validating the will, managing the estate, paying debts and taxes, and distributing assets to beneficiaries.

9. How can I avoid probate in Alexandria, Egypt?

You can avoid probate in Alexandria, Egypt by establishing a living trust, designating beneficiaries on financial accounts, and gifting assets during your lifetime.

10. How much does probate cost in Alexandria, Egypt?

The cost of probate in Alexandria, Egypt can vary depending on the complexity of the case and any legal fees involved. It is important to consider these costs when planning your estate.
